Transaction 07947e77496e275c9fcdf21dfb74c2a37e992d05d3c155144578f8a30898e2e4

1 Input
1 Outputs
  • 07947e77496e275c9fcdf21dfb74c2a37e992d05d3c155144578f8a30898e2e4:0
  • value  124396
    address  32Khjh2dW7W4qJtFpctLBJAQqt7synyEvx